Bournemouth
1983–84 season
Manager Don Megson/ Harry Redknapp
Stadium Dean Court
Third Division 17th
FA Cup Fourth Round
League Cup First Round
Associate Members Cup Champions

During the 1983–84 English football season, AFC Bournemouth competed in the Football League Third Division.
